Output 66c36a6d08e5c79fa31d7dbcc3c730a7a85eeb52c3233a428c4746237cf57e42:1

value
73154453
script pubkey
OP_0 OP_PUSHBYTES_20 36d5c86e947fc97350c89118ed0bb42ef9094a95
address
ltc1qxm2usm550lyhx5xgjyvw6za59musjj540z4gnl
transaction
66c36a6d08e5c79fa31d7dbcc3c730a7a85eeb52c3233a428c4746237cf57e42
spent
true